N.Z. SCOTTISH REGIMENT
FORMATION APPROVED (Pur Press Association.) WELLINGTON, this day. The official notification of the intention to form a New Zealand Scottish regiment, contained in the Gazette last night, reads: "The Gov-ernor-General is pleased to approve, under the Defence Act, 1909, of the formation of the under-mentioned unit of 'lie territorial force: A New Zealand Scottish regiment, with headquarters at Wellington."
